The 16 Sutras of Vedic Mathematics

The core of Vedic Mathematics is based on 16 sutras or aphorisms. These sutras form the foundation, making the calculation of complex equations straightforward. Here’s a quick overview of some of these sutras:

  • Ekadhikena Purvena (By One More Than the Previous Digit): This helps with squaring numbers ending in 5.
  • Nikhilam Navatashcaramam Dashatah (All from 9 and the Last from 10): A shortcut for subtraction from bases of 10, 100, 1000, etc.
  • Anurupyena (Proportionately): Useful for multiplication.

Understanding Vedic Mathematics begins with familiarity with these 16 sutras. Learning them by heart is the key to unlocking the true potential of Vedic Mathematics.

Basic Techniques and Formulas

Understanding Vedic Mathematics involves getting to grips with its foundational techniques. Here’s a rundown of some simple methods:

a. Squaring Numbers Ending in 5

For squaring any number ending in 5, take the first digit of the number, multiply it by the next higher number, and add 25 at the end.

Example:

  • 35235^2352: Take 3 (the first digit), multiply by 4 (next higher), resulting in 12. Attach 25, so 352=122535^2 = 1225352=1225.

b. The Vertically and Crosswise Method for Multiplication

This technique simplifies the multiplication of two-digit numbers.

Example:

  • 23×2423 \times 2423×24: Multiply vertically (2 and 2), crosswise (2 and 3 with 2 and 4), and again vertically (3 and 4). Add results, yielding 23×24=55223 \times 24 = 55223×24=552.

1. What is Vedic Mathematics?

Answer: Vedic Mathematics is an ancient Indian system of mathematics derived from the Vedas, primarily the Atharva Veda. It consists of 16 sutras (formulas or aphorisms) that simplify complex calculations and enhance mental math skills.
